it is a photo-editing app that make group picture perfect by swapping out the imperfect parts like closed eyes or unintentional poses. other than group/family photos, this app is also useful for people like me who often take photos with kids & dogs. it's always so difficult to get Jayvier & my dachshunds to look at the camera lens. the photos will either turn out they are looking at the wrong way or i wasn't smiling at my best. i know photoshop can be done to merge several photos into a perfect one but i have yet to master such pro PS skills. here's an example of how easy a good shot can be created just by a few clicks away using GroupShot.

| just like most of the photo apps, you can choose to take a new photo or upload from your camera roll |
 |
| the uploaded photos should be nearly identical to get a great result |
 |
| "yellow out" the imperfection by swiping over the face that you want to remove |
 |
| replace with a face that's looking at the camera from the right column & wait for the transformation |
 |
| ta-dah! |
 |
| save the new photo to your camera library or share it through e-mail, Facebook or Twitter |
the only bottom line is that it's not a free app. i downloaded it at US$0.99, which is a introductory price for a limited time. i'm obsessed with photos apps so i don't mind to pay a small amount of money for a good & easy-to-use app like this. ^^
